Understanding hydraulic hose fittings is essential for global buyers. These fittings connect hoses, tubes, and pipes in hydraulic systems. It's crucial to know the types available, including JIC, NPT, and BSP. Each type serves different purposes in various applications. Selecting the right fitting ensures system efficiency and safety.
Consider the materials used for the fittings. Common materials include steel and brass. Steel fittings are durable and can withstand high pressures. Brass is resistant to corrosion, making it suitable for certain environments. However, improper material selection can lead to leaks or failures. Buyers should weigh the pros and cons of each material type.
Fitting sizes and specifications are also vital. Correct sizing prevents leaks and maintains pressure within the system. However, global standards may differ, leading to confusion. Buyers must review specifications thoroughly to avoid mismatched fittings. It’s important to ask questions and seek expert advice when unsure. Understanding these basics helps avoid costly mistakes and ensures a more reliable hydraulic system.

Hydraulic hose fittings play a crucial role in connecting hoses to various components. Understanding their types can enhance efficiency in different applications. Common types include JIC, NPT, and BSP fittings, each serving specific purposes. JIC fittings offer a reliable connection for high-pressure systems. Meanwhile, NPT fittings are ideal for sealing. BSP fittings are popular in Europe for parallel connections.
When choosing fittings, consider material compatibility. Using the wrong material can lead to failures. Stainless steel is durable but may not suit all environments. In addition, proper installation is vital to avoid leaks. Inspect connections regularly to ensure safety.

When evaluating vendors, focus on their certifications and manufacturing processes. Industry standards like ISO 9001 ensure the manufacturer adheres to quality management principles. Requesting detailed specifications for materials used can reveal a lot about the product's longevity and reliability. Be wary of overly affordable options; they often compromise on material integrity.
Furthermore, engaging in trials or testing samples before bulk purchases can help assess compatibility and performance. Real-world testing can uncover issues that specifications may not reveal.
